Top 20 Lakes around Heppenheim

Lakes around Heppenheim, situated in the Hessische Bergstrasse region, offer diverse recreational opportunities. The area features various bodies of water, ranging from forest lakes to bathing lakes. These natural features contribute to the region's appeal for outdoor activities. Visitors can find opportunities for relaxation, walking, and observing nature.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of lakes can I find around Heppenheim?

The Heppenheim region offers a variety of lakes, including serene forest lakes and larger bathing lakes with sandy beaches. You can find options for active recreation or peaceful relaxation.

Which lakes near Heppenheim are suitable for swimming?

For swimming, you can visit Waidsee, which has a lido and free access points, or Wiesensee Hemsbach, a popular open-air bathing lake with extensive lawns. Badesee Bensheim also offers a 300-meter-long sandy beach and clear water.

Are there walking or cycling paths around the lakes?

Yes, many lakes offer pleasant paths. For example, Bruchsee Heppenheim has paved pathways encircling the lake, ideal for walkers and cyclists. You can also find trails around forest lakes like Niederwald Lake.

What kind of hiking opportunities are available near the lakes?

The area around Heppenheim's lakes provides various hiking options. You can explore trails near forest lakes or combine your visit with longer routes. For more extensive hiking, consider routes from the Hiking around Heppenheim guide, which includes paths like the 'View of Hemsberg – Starkenburg loop'.

Which lakes are suitable for families with children?

Several lakes are family-friendly. Bruchsee Heppenheim features a playground and exercise course. Swan Pond at Fürstenlager Park and Fairy Pond are also noted as family-friendly spots, offering idyllic settings for a leisurely visit.

Are dogs allowed at the lakes around Heppenheim?

While specific regulations vary by lake, many natural areas around Heppenheim are generally dog-friendly, especially on walking paths. It's always best to check local signage for specific rules regarding swimming or off-leash areas at each individual lake.

What natural features can I observe at the lakes?

The lakes offer diverse natural beauty. Bruchsee Heppenheim features a bird park and a reed bed at its southern end, enhancing its natural appeal. Forest lakes like Groß-Breitenbach Forest Lake provide serene environments for nature observation.

Are there any facilities or amenities available at the lakes?

Some lakes offer facilities. Waidsee has a lido and mooring for small vessels. Bruchsee Heppenheim includes park benches, a playground, and an exercise course. Wiesensee Hemsbach provides well-maintained lawns, shade, and extensive parking facilities.

What do visitors enjoy most about the lakes around Heppenheim?

Visitors appreciate the diverse recreational opportunities, from active pursuits like swimming and cycling to tranquil activities such as walking and wildlife observation. Many highlight the idyllic settings, like the 'beautiful romantic spot' of the Fairy Pond, and the peaceful relaxation offered by places like Groß-Breitenbach Forest Lake.

How can I reach the lakes by public transport?

Wiesensee Hemsbach is well-connected by bus, making it easily accessible. For other lakes, public transport options may vary, and it's advisable to check local bus routes or train connections to nearby towns, often followed by a short walk or cycle.

Are there opportunities for road cycling near the lakes?

Yes, the region around Heppenheim is popular for road cycling. You can find routes that pass by or near some of the lakes. For detailed routes, refer to the Road Cycling Routes around Heppenheim guide, which includes options like the 'Weschnitz Riverside Path'.

Is wild swimming permitted in any of the lakes?

While some lakes like Waidsee, Wiesensee Hemsbach, and Badesee Bensheim are designated for swimming, wild swimming in undesignated areas or forest lakes like Niederwald Lake is generally prohibited to ensure safety and preserve natural habitats. Always look for official swimming areas.

What is the best time of year to visit the lakes?

The lakes are enjoyable year-round, but the warmer months from late spring to early autumn are ideal for swimming and water activities. During autumn, the forest lakes offer beautiful foliage, and winter provides opportunities for peaceful walks, though swimming is not recommended.
